Comprehending the Role of a Qualified Nursing Assistant
The duty of a Certified Nursing Aide (CNA) is crucial in the medical care system, acting as the backbone of person treatment. As a CNA, you supply straight support to individuals, assisting them with everyday tasks like showering, dressing, and eating. You monitor crucial signs and report any adjustments in an individual's condition to the nursing staff, making certain prompt interventions. Your interaction skills are critical, as you function as a bridge in between clients and health care companies. You'll also keep a clean and risk-free setting, which is crucial for individual recovery. By developing relationships with people, you assist produce a calming atmosphere, promoting depend on and self-respect. Inevitably, your work considerably impacts clients' total health and well-being in their healing trip.
Crucial Abilities Taught in CNA Classes
While going after CNA classes, you'll get a range of necessary abilities that prepare you for hands-on client treatment. Initially, you'll find out proper strategies for bathing, grooming, and clothing clients, ensuring their self-respect and comfort. You'll also master vital indication dimension, which is critical for keeping track of client health. Communication skills are stressed, allowing you to properly connect with individuals and health care groups. Infection control procedures are instructed to preserve a risk-free environment. Additionally, you'll gain expertise in standard nourishment and movement support, helping people with everyday activities. You'll additionally create compassion and concern, essential traits in providing emotional support. These abilities not only enhance your capacities yet also encourage you to make a positive impact in people' lives

What Is the Normal Duration of CNA Training Programs?
CNA training programs typically last in between 4 to twelve weeks, relying on the establishment and educational program. You'll obtain crucial abilities and expertise to prepare you for a rewarding job in medical care throughout this moment.
Are Online CNA Courses Available and Reliable?
Yes, on-line CNA courses are offered and can be effective. You'll find flexible timetables and obtainable products, however confirm the program's accredited to fulfill your state's demands and offer hands-on training opportunities.
What Are the Expenses Connected With CNA Classes?
CNA course expenses vary extensively, usually ranging from $300 to $2,000. Factors like area, organization, and whether you choose online or in-person programs influence these rates. It's vital to research alternatives that fit your budget plan.
Do CNA Certifications Expire, and Just How Do I Renew Them?
Yes, CNA certifications try this site do run out, usually after 2 years. To renew your own, you'll require to complete proceeding education hours and send a revival application to your state's nursing board, ensuring you remain current in your abilities.
What Job Settings Can CNAS Operate In After Accreditation?
After qualification, you can operate in different setups like health centers, nursing homes, aided living facilities, and home medical care. Each environment supplies special experiences, allowing you to supply important support to people in demand.
